The Math Behind Your One Life
The average American works from age 22 to 65 β 43 years. At 40 hours per week, 50 weeks per year, that is 86,000 scheduled work hours. Add a conservative 45-minute daily commute (both ways) and 30 minutes of daily prep time: another 20,000 hours. Total work-related hours: approximately 106,000 over a career.
Now compare that to the total waking hours available over a lifetime from 22 to 80: about 348,000 waking hours. Work consumes roughly 30% of those hours. But during the working years specifically, the proportion is much higher β roughly 40-50% of waking time, leaving 15-25 free waking hours per week during career years.
This is not an argument against work. Most people find meaning in their careers. But it is an argument for precision: you are making implicit decisions every day about how your finite life is allocated, and most people have never calculated what those implicit decisions actually look like in aggregate. When the numbers are visible, choices about remote work, commute length, retirement timing, and working hours become clearer.

Calculate your total waking hours from now to life expectancy
Total life hours = (life expectancy - current age) Γ 365.25 Γ 24. Subtract sleep hours to get total waking hours. This is the finite pool from which everything β work, family, hobbies, rest, travel, health β must come. Most people from 30 to 80 have approximately 250,000-280,000 waking hours remaining.
- 2
Quantify your total work-related hours
Work-related hours = (scheduled work hours per week + commute hours per day Γ 2 Γ 5 + prep hours per day Γ 5) Γ work weeks per year Γ working years remaining. For most full-time workers, this figure is 80,000-120,000 hours over a career β 30-45% of total waking life.
- 3
Calculate your truly free time
Truly free waking time = total waking hours minus work-related hours minus basic life maintenance (cooking, errands, medical, roughly 15-20 hours/week). The resulting figure β often 15-25 years of waking time over a lifetime β is the most motivating number in this analysis. It makes clear that discretionary time is finite and non-renewable.
- 4
Model the scenarios that most change the outcome
Three levers dramatically affect the allocation: (1) retirement age β retiring 5 years earlier recovers 1-2 years of free life; (2) commute β eliminating a 1-hour daily commute recovers 1-3 years of career-span free time; (3) work hours β a 4-day week recovers 20% of all work-related time. Run all three to understand which has the highest impact on your specific situation. Most people find that retirement age and commute are the highest-leverage variables.
- 5
Use the weekly view to make daily decisions
The lifetime view creates motivation; the weekly view creates action. Your free waking hours per week β typically 15-25 during working years β is the budget you actually manage day-to-day. Guard those hours as deliberately as you guard money. Time for exercise, sleep, relationships, and recovery are not luxuries to fit in β they are the substance of what makes the other hours worthwhile.
Life and Work β Common Questions
Is this calculation meant to make me feel bad about working?
+
No β it is meant to make your trade-offs visible so you can make them intentionally rather than by default. Work has real value beyond income: social connection, structure, purpose, and identity. The point of the calculation is not that work is bad but that its time cost is larger than most people realize, which should inform decisions about commute length, overtime habits, retirement timing, and career choices.
What should I do with my free weekly hours?
+
Research on subjective well-being consistently shows that time invested in physical health (exercise, sleep), strong relationships, and activities with intrinsic engagement produces far more lasting satisfaction than equivalent time spent on passive consumption. The free hours you have are most valuable when used actively. The calculator is deliberately neutral on this β it shows you how many hours you have, not how to spend them.
How does remote work change the calculation?
+
Remote work eliminates commute time entirely β often 500-1,000+ hours per year. It also reduces prep time for many workers. Over a 30-year career, eliminating a 1-hour daily commute recovers approximately 15,000-17,500 hours β roughly 2 years of continuous free time. This is why the financial equivalence calculation (remote work = meaningful raise) consistently undervalues remote work: the life-time value of recovered commute hours is not captured by salary comparisons alone.
How accurate is life expectancy in this calculation?
+
The life expectancy input affects the denominator (total life hours) but not the work-related hours, which are bounded by your working years. The calculation is most useful for understanding the proportion of your remaining working years that goes to work vs. free time, and for comparing different retirement age scenarios. Use your personal health history and family longevity patterns to calibrate β and build a conservative buffer, since underestimating longevity is more consequential than overestimating it.
